Introduction of Painkiller Stockists in Spain
Painkillers in Spain been available in different types, consisting of non-prescription (OTC) medications and prescription drugs. The stockists vary from large pharmaceutical wholesalers to regional drug stores. Below is a breakdown of the primary channels through which painkillers are distributed in Spain.

Table 1: Types of Painkillers Available in Spain
| Kind of Painkiller | Description | Schedule |
|---|---|---|
| OTC Painkillers | Medications that can be purchased without a prescription, such as ibuprofen and paracetamol. | Widely available in drug stores and grocery stores. |
| Prescription Painkillers | Stronger medications that need a medical professional's prescription, such as opioids and particular NSAIDs. | Only offered at pharmacies with a legitimate prescription. |
| Topical Pain Relief | Creams, gels, and spots utilized for localized pain relief. | Readily available OTC and by prescription. |
| Alternative Remedies | Supplements and herbal treatments, often marketed as natural pain relief options. | Offered at health stores and some pharmacies. |
The Role of Pharmacies in Painkiller Distribution
Pharmacies play a pivotal function in the distribution of pain relief medications in Spain. They serve as the very first point of access for the public, offering both OTC and prescription pain relievers.
Kinds of Pharmacies in Spain
Neighborhood Pharmacies: These are the most typical and are situated in metropolitan and rural areas. They supply a wide variety of painkillers and use assessment services.
Health center Pharmacies: Situated within hospitals, these pharmacies mostly provide medications to inpatients however might likewise supply outpatient services.

Trends in Painkiller Consumption
Recent research studies reveal that painkiller usage in Spain has actually been on the increase, affected by an aging population and increased frequency of persistent pain disorders.
Key Statistics
- According to the current information from the Ministry of Health, over 35% of grownups reported using pain relievers in the in 2015.
- Ibuprofen and paracetamol represent almost 60% of painkiller sales in the OTC market.
- The prescription market for painkillers has seen an annual development rate of 5%, driven mainly by the rise in chronic conditions.

Difficulties Faced by Painkiller Stockists
Despite the growing demand for pain relievers, stockists in Spain face a number of challenges:
Regulatory Compliance: Keeping abreast of continuously evolving regulations can be troublesome for stockists.
Supply Chain Issues: Disruptions due to global events (e.g., pandemics) can impact the availability of painkillers.
Customer Awareness: Many consumers are not fully informed about the appropriate usage and possible risks of painkillers.
